在线可视化看板API文档完善吗?开发指南

阅读人数:385预计阅读时长:6 min

在线可视化看板在现代企业中扮演着至关重要的角色,它们不仅可以帮助企业实时监控数据,还能直观地展示复杂的信息。然而,对于开发者而言,完善的API文档是成功开发和部署在线看板的关键因素。然而,现实情况往往是,很多API文档让开发者感到困惑,甚至导致开发效率下降或出现错误。因此,探讨在线可视化看板API文档是否完善以及如何编写详细的开发指南,显得尤为重要。

在线可视化看板API文档完善吗?开发指南

🛠️ 一、API文档的重要性

1. API文档的核心作用

API文档是开发者与软件功能之间的桥梁。一个完善的API文档能够显著提升开发者的工作效率,降低开发过程中的错误发生率。它不仅仅是函数调用的说明书,更是开发者理解系统架构和功能的指南。

例如,在开发可视化看板时,开发者需要清楚地知道如何调用API来获取数据、如何配置图表、如何设置响应式布局等。这些操作如果没有详细的文档说明,很可能会导致开发者花费大量时间去摸索,甚至可能误解功能的实现方式。

API文档的关键组成部分包括:

  • 功能描述:每个API接口的功能说明。
  • 参数细节:接口所需的参数及其类型、默认值和限制。
  • 返回数据:接口调用后返回的数据结构及示例。
  • 错误处理:可能出现的错误类型及对应的解决方案。

    这些部分的完备与否直接影响开发者的使用体验和开发效率。

2. 案例分析:完善文档的影响

以知名数据可视化工具Tableau为例,其API文档以详细和易于理解著称。Tableau的文档中不仅包括API接口的基本使用说明,还提供了丰富的示例代码、常见问题解答以及开发者社区的支持。这种多层次的文档结构使得开发者能够快速上手,并能在遇到问题时迅速找到答案。相较之下,一些小众工具由于缺乏详细的文档支持,开发者往往需要花费额外的时间来进行自我探索。

综合来看,API文档的完善与否不仅影响开发者的使用体验,还关系到产品的市场竞争力。企业在选择数据可视化工具时,也会考虑文档的完整性和清晰度,因为这直接关系到项目的实施效率。

功能 详细描述 示例
功能描述 API接口的具体功能说明 获取用户数据的API用于从数据库中提取用户信息
参数细节 参数类型及要求 `userId`为必填整数类型参数
返回数据 返回值格式及示例 返回`JSON`格式,包含`name`和`email`字段

3. 完善文档的编写技巧

完善的API文档不仅仅是简单的接口说明,还需要:

  • 用户视角:站在开发者的角度考虑,提供清晰的使用场景和示例。
  • 持续更新:API文档需要随着版本更新及时调整,保证内容的准确性。
  • 多语言支持:考虑到不同开发者的需求,提供多语言版本以便全球化应用。

结论:完善的API文档是成功产品的基础,它不仅提高了开发者的效率,也提升了产品的用户满意度。企业在开发数据可视化工具时,应该高度重视API文档的质量和完整性。

🚀 二、开发指南的关键要素

1. 开发指南的定义与意义

开发指南是一份为开发者提供具体实施步骤和最佳实践的文档。它不仅详细说明了如何使用API,还包含如何集成、测试和部署应用程序的详细步骤。

一个完善的开发指南能够让开发者快速掌握工具的使用方法,减少开发过程中的试错时间。特别是在复杂的企业项目中,开发指南的重要性尤为突出。它能够帮助团队成员在同一个标准下进行开发,从而提高协作效率。

2. 案例分析:开发指南的实践

以微服务架构为例,Netflix提供了详细的开发指南,帮助开发者构建和部署基于其技术栈的应用程序。Netflix的指南包括从环境配置、代码示例到性能优化的全流程指导。这种详细的指导文档帮助开发者在短时间内掌握复杂系统的构建方法。

在数据可视化领域,FineVis作为一款零代码的可视化设计工具,其开发指南同样是深入详尽的。FineVis不仅提供了如何使用其内置图表类型和样式的说明,还包括如何利用拖拽组件快速设计可视化看板的详细步骤。这些指南帮助用户在短时间内完成数据可视化任务,无需深入的编程背景。

3. 开发指南的编写要点

  • 结构清晰:分章节说明,不同的功能模块要有独立的说明,便于查阅。
  • 图文并茂:通过图片、视频等多媒体形式直观展示操作步骤。
  • 示例丰富:提供实际应用案例,帮助开发者理解如何在真实场景中应用。
  • 版本管理:确保文档与软件版本同步更新,避免信息过时。
要素 描述 示例
结构清晰 模块化分章节 配置指南、使用指南、API参考
图文并茂 结合多媒体展示 使用GIF展示操作流程
示例丰富 提供实际应用场景 示例项目展示如何集成第三方API
版本管理 文档与软件同步更新 每次版本更新附带更新日志

借助这些要点,开发指南能够真正成为开发者的“指路明灯”,引导他们高效地完成项目。

4. 开发指南的挑战与解决方案

在实际编写过程中,开发指南常常面临以下挑战:

  • 信息冗余:如何在提供详尽信息的同时避免过多细节导致的复杂性?
  • 用户多样化:如何兼顾新手与专家开发者的不同需求?
  • 技术更新:如何快速响应软件更新并及时调整指南内容?

解决方案包括:

  • 内容精简:聚焦核心功能,使用层级目录引导深入了解。
  • 用户分级:提供基础与高级两种版本指南,满足不同水平开发者需求。
  • 敏捷更新:建立文档管理流程,确保快速响应技术变化。

结论:开发指南不仅仅是技术说明书,它是开发者在探索复杂软件功能时的重要工具。一个好的开发指南能够显著提升团队的开发效率和项目质量。

📊 三、在线可视化看板API文档与开发指南的优化策略

1. 当前市场的痛点分析

目前市场上许多数据可视化工具的API文档与开发指南往往存在以下痛点:

  • 信息不完整:仅涵盖基本功能,忽略常见问题及解决方案。
  • 结构混乱:缺乏清晰的结构,查找信息费时费力。
  • 缺乏示例:缺少实际操作示例,开发者难以理解具体应用。

这些问题导致开发者在使用工具时,常常需要依赖外部资源或社区帮助,增加了学习成本和开发时间。

2. API文档与开发指南的优化策略

  • 全面覆盖:确保文档涵盖所有功能模块,包括常见问题和解决方案。
  • 结构优化:采用模块化结构,便于快速定位所需信息。
  • 丰富示例:提供完整的代码示例和应用场景,帮助开发者快速上手。
  • 用户反馈机制:建立用户反馈渠道,定期更新文档内容,反映用户需求。
优化策略 描述 预期效果
全面覆盖 包含所有功能和常见问题 减少开发者查找外部资源的时间
结构优化 模块化、清晰的目录结构 提高查找效率
丰富示例 提供完整的代码和应用案例 帮助开发者快速掌握实践
用户反馈机制 定期收集反馈并更新 持续提升文档质量

通过这些策略,可以显著提升API文档和开发指南的实用性和用户体验。

3. 实践中的成功案例

在实践中,GitHub的API文档优化策略值得借鉴。GitHub通过引入用户反馈机制和文档开放编辑,确保文档的实时更新和高质量。这种模式不仅提高了文档的准确性和实用性,还增强了用户参与感。

在数据可视化领域,FineVis也通过提供丰富的在线文档和互动示例,帮助用户在短时间内掌握工具的使用。这种方式有效降低了用户的学习曲线,提高了工具的市场竞争力。

4. 未来的发展方向

随着技术的不断发展,在线可视化看板的API文档和开发指南也需要不断演进。未来的发展方向包括:

  • 智能化:引入AI技术,自动生成代码示例和个性化指南。
  • 交互式文档:通过可交互的在线平台,提供更直观的学习体验。
  • 全球化支持:多语言、多文化背景的文档支持,满足全球用户需求。

结论:通过不断优化和创新,在线可视化看板的API文档和开发指南能够更好地支持开发者,提高工具的使用效率和用户满意度。

📚 结论

通过本文的探讨,我们可以看到,完善的API文档和开发指南是数据可视化工具成功的关键要素。无论是API文档的清晰度和完整性,还是开发指南的实用性和及时更新,都直接影响到开发者的使用体验和工具的市场竞争力。在技术飞速发展的今天,企业需要不断优化这些文档,以适应用户不断变化的需求。FineVis作为优秀的可视化设计工具,通过其详细的文档和用户友好的界面,为企业在数据可视化领域提供了强有力的支持。

参考文献

  1. Martin, R. C. (2008). Clean Code: A Handbook of Agile Software Craftsmanship. Prentice Hall.
  2. Fowler, M. (2018). Refactoring: Improving the Design of Existing Code. Addison-Wesley.
  3. Johnson, S., & Gouseti, A. (2017). Digital Tools for Qualitative Research. SAGE Publications.

    本文相关FAQs

📊 在线可视化看板的API文档真的够用吗?

在企业数字化转型过程中,老板要求团队快速上手可视化工具,但面对海量的API文档,常常不知从何下手。有没有大佬能分享一下这些文档是否全面、易用?文档的质量会直接影响到项目的进度和最终效果,大家有什么经验分享吗?


在选择和使用在线可视化看板工具时,API文档的完整性和可读性是关键因素。API文档的完善程度直接影响开发者的上手速度和开发效率。一个完善的API文档应具备以下几个特征:全面覆盖功能、清晰的使用示例、详细的参数说明以及常见问题的解答。这些特征不仅帮助开发者理解如何调用API,还能快速找到解决方案,避免走弯路。

全面覆盖功能意味着文档中列出的API应该涵盖工具的所有功能模块,这样开发者在实现复杂功能时,不会因为找不到需要的API而束手无策。API文档应提供清晰的使用示例,帮助开发者快速理解如何实现某一具体功能。例如,一个好的可视化看板API文档会详细说明如何通过API实现数据的动态更新和图表的实时渲染,这是很多企业用户在构建实时监控系统时的核心需求。

详细的参数说明是衡量API文档质量的重要标志。开发者需要知道每个参数的作用、数据类型以及可能的取值范围,以避免因为参数错误而导致的bug。在这方面,FineVis的API文档提供了详细的参数说明,帮助开发者避免常见的错误。

最后,API文档中如果能包含常见问题的解答,将大大降低开发者在使用过程中的困惑。比如,FineVis的文档中列出了常见的集成问题及应对策略,为开发者提供了很多实用的建议。

总之,API文档的质量直接关系到开发者的工作效率和项目的成功率。选择像FineVis这样配有完善API文档的工具,可以为开发者提供极大的便利和支持。 FineVis大屏Demo免费体验


🛠️ 如何根据在线可视化看板的开发指南进行快速开发?

公司最近要求搭建一个数据可视化看板,时间紧任务重。虽然有开发指南,但内容繁杂,有没有简化的步骤或者关键点指南?有没有大佬能分享一下如何根据这些指南进行快速开发?


开发在线可视化看板的过程,虽然有详细的指南,但面对繁杂的内容,开发者容易迷失方向。为了实现快速开发,首先需要明确几个关键点:明确需求、选择合适的工具、熟悉工具的功能,以及灵活运用开发指南

可视化大屏

第一步,开发团队需要与业务部门紧密沟通,明确看板的具体需求,包括数据来源、展示的指标、用户的交互需求等。在明确需求后,选择合适的工具尤为重要。像FineVis这样的工具,因为其零代码设计和多样化的图表类型,可以显著提高开发效率。

熟悉工具的功能是快速开发的基础。开发指南通常会详细介绍工具的各个模块及其功能,这里建议开发者重点关注数据连接、图表设计和布局管理等核心模块。例如,FineVis的开发指南中介绍了如何通过简单的拖拽操作来实现复杂的可视化效果,这对于时间紧迫的项目尤为重要。

最后,在阅读开发指南时,可以先浏览目录和大纲,抓住重点章节,快速了解工具的基本使用方法。对于一些细节问题,可以在具体开发过程中再进行查阅。

通过明确需求、选择合适工具、熟悉工具功能和灵活运用开发指南,开发者可以在短时间内完成高质量的数据可视化看板,实现项目的快速交付。


🚀 如何应对在线可视化看板开发中的实操难点?

尽管有API文档和开发指南支持,但实际开发过程中总会遇到各种难点。比如性能优化、数据动态更新、跨平台适配等等。这些问题怎么解决?有没有实用的技巧和经验分享?


在在线可视化看板的开发中,实操难点往往让开发者头疼不已。常见问题包括性能优化、数据动态更新、跨平台适配等,这些问题需要结合具体的开发环境和业务需求进行针对性处理。

性能优化是可视化看板开发中的一大难点,尤其是在处理大数据量时。为了提升性能,开发者可以采取数据预处理、按需加载和缓存机制等策略。例如,FineVis支持数据预处理和按需加载,开发者可以通过这些功能有效减少数据传输量,提高看板的响应速度。

数据动态更新是实时监控类看板的核心需求。为了实现数据的动态更新,开发者可以采用WebSocket等技术,与数据源建立实时连接,确保数据的实时性和准确性。FineVis提供了良好的动态数据支持,使开发者能够轻松实现这一功能。

跨平台适配是保证用户体验的一项挑战。为了在不同设备上提供一致的用户体验,开发者需要在设计阶段就考虑到大屏、PC端和移动端的适配问题。FineVis支持自适应布局模式,开发者可以利用这些功能,轻松实现跨平台的无缝适配。

面对这些实操难点,开发者需要充分利用工具提供的功能模块,结合自身的业务需求进行灵活应用。同时,定期回顾项目中的问题和解决方案,不断积累经验,以提高开发效率和项目质量。

三维可视化

通过这些方法,开发者可以有效应对可视化看板开发中的各种难点,确保项目的顺利推进和高质量交付。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

帆软软件深耕数字行业,能够基于强大的底层数据仓库与数据集成技术,为企业梳理指标体系,建立全面、便捷、直观的经营、财务、绩效、风险和监管一体化的报表系统与数据分析平台,并为各业务部门人员及领导提供PC端、移动端等可视化大屏查看方式,有效提高工作效率与需求响应速度。若想了解更多产品信息,您可以访问下方链接,或点击组件,快速获得免费的产品试用、同行业标杆案例,以及帆软为您企业量身定制的企业数字化建设解决方案。

评论区

Avatar for data画布人
data画布人

我觉得这篇文章的信息量很丰富,尤其是关于新技术的应用部分,给了我很多启发。

2025年7月9日
点赞
赞 (98)
Avatar for 可视化编排者
可视化编排者

文章内容很有趣,但我不太确定如何在现有系统中实施这些技术,希望能有更多操作指南。

2025年7月9日
点赞
赞 (39)
Avatar for 数仓旅者V2
数仓旅者V2

感谢作者的详细分析,不过对于初学者来说,可能需要更简单的案例来理解复杂概念。

2025年7月9日
点赞
赞 (18)
Avatar for ETL_学徒99
ETL_学徒99

我很喜欢这篇文章对各种技术优缺点的对比,但希望能有更多实际应用场景的讨论。

2025年7月9日
点赞
赞 (0)
Avatar for 模板搬运官
模板搬运官

文章中提到的技术解决方案很吸引人,不过不知道兼容性问题是否已经解决,有人能分享经验吗?

2025年7月9日
点赞
赞 (0)
电话咨询图标电话咨询icon产品激活iconicon在线咨询